1950 Quarter, MS67+
Delicately Toned, Tied for Finest
Doubled Die Reverse
1950 25C Doubled Die Reverse, FS-801, MS67+ PCGS. A Registry
Set essential, this high-end Superb Gem 1950 quarter is
CAC-approved as one of the finest certified by either service. The
strike is bold, and the preservation is nearly flawless. Both sides
display satiny champagne luster with iridescent hues near the
extreme outer peripheries. FS-801 shows bold die doubling on the
reverse at the eagle's beak and is rare this fine. Population (all
varieties included): 71 in 67 (8 in 67+), 0 finer; (FS-801) 7 in 67
(2 in 67+), 0 finer (2/18).From The jwb1040 Collection, Part II.
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 245S, Variety PCGS# 145633, Base PCGS# 5841, Greysheet# 227309)
Weight: 6.25 grams
Metal: 90% Silver, 10% Copper
